Trick Components of Product Packaging Machines

Packaging devices include a number of key parts that collaborate to make sure reliable and efficient product packaging procedures. At the core of these machines is the frame, which offers structural honesty and houses the various operating parts. The drive system, frequently a combination of equipments and motors, promotes the activity of elements, enabling precise operation throughout the packaging cycle.

Another vital part is the conveyor system, which transfers items with various stages of the product packaging process. This is often enhanced by sensing units and controls that monitor the setting and speed of things, making certain synchronization and decreasing errors. The filling up system is vital for accurately dispensing the appropriate quantity of item right into bundles, whether in liquid, powder, or solid kind.

Sealing devices, consisting of warm sealants or sticky applicators, play a vital duty in securing packages, preventing contamination and expanding service life. In addition, identifying systems are integral for supplying needed item details, making sure conformity with regulations. The control panel, geared up with user-friendly interfaces, permits operators to take care of device features, display performance, and make changes as needed, making certain optimal efficiency and effectiveness in product packaging procedures.

Common Maintenance Problems

Effective operation of product packaging equipments counts heavily on normal upkeep to avoid usual issues that can interfere with manufacturing. Amongst these issues, mechanical wear and tear prevails, especially in parts like motors, seals, and conveyors, which can cause unforeseen downtimes. Furthermore, misalignment of components can cause ineffective operation, creating products to be inaccurately packaged or harmed throughout the process.

Electrical problems, commonly stemming from loose links or damaged electrical wiring, can disrupt equipment features, leading to substantial production hold-ups. Software problems due to outdated programs or inappropriate setups can impede the equipment's operation, requiring instant treatment. Resolving these usual maintenance concerns proactively is vital for ensuring optimum efficiency and longevity of product packaging equipment.

Preventative Upkeep Techniques

Implementing preventative maintenance strategies is vital for sustaining the effectiveness and integrity of packaging equipments. By sticking to an arranged upkeep program, operators can identify damage on components before they cause significant breakdowns.

Trick elements of a preventative upkeep strategy consist of regular examinations, cleansing, lubrication, and element replacements based on manufacturer suggestions. Making use of checklists can streamline this process, guaranteeing that no vital jobs are ignored. Additionally, keeping accurate records of maintenance activities aids in tracking the machine's performance with time, promoting educated decision-making relating to future maintenance requirements.

Educating personnel on the relevance of preventative maintenance boosts compliance and cultivates a culture of positive care. Executing a predictive maintenance component, utilizing data analytics and sensor modern technology, can even more optimize machinery performance by forecasting failures before they occur.

Repair Service and Substitute Best Practices

A detailed understanding of repair work and substitute best methods is important for keeping the longevity and efficiency of packaging makers. On a regular basis analyzing the problem of machine elements enables timely intervention, preventing even more substantial problems that can bring about costly downtimes.

When repair work are needed, it is important to utilize OEM (Original Equipment Producer) parts to ensure compatibility and efficiency. This not just maintains the stability of the maker yet additionally promotes warranty contracts. Additionally, it is recommended to preserve a supply of critical spare components to help with quick substitutes and minimize functional disturbances.

For complicated fixings, engaging licensed service technicians with specialized training in packaging equipment is recommended. They have the experience to diagnose concerns precisely and carry out repair work efficiently. In addition, recording all fixing tasks and parts substitutes is critical for preserving a thorough maintenance history, which can help in future troubleshooting.

Finally, carrying out a proactive strategy, including normal evaluations and anticipating upkeep techniques, improves the dependability of product packaging machines. By adhering to these ideal techniques, businesses can guarantee optimal device performance, minimize functional threats, and expand equipment life expectancy.
